NEW! Hand Died Yarn - New Bluefaced Leicester wool - Fingering - 100gr/400m - UPDATE!
This one is a superwash a little thiner than the old one. The colours are a lighter version of my last alpaca/silk. The difference is that this one is not variegated, the colors tones are mixed along the yarns. First I thought it was the new australian wool, but after it completely dryed and looked my stock carefully, found out I had an extra bluefaced pack and 1 less australian merino...
But the yarn is still great and soft :)

Slowly coming back to knitting....
As you may have noted, I have hand dyed much more than usual...
It happened because I was unable to knit for medical reasons...
I started slowly with only knits stitches and took back my "Cameo" shawl from PaulinaP. You can find the pattern on Ravelry here:
http://www.ravelry.com/patterns/library/cameo-8
I'm only in the beginning so it's just knits, kf/b and picot.
Not ready to get back to lacy shawls yet...and I don't think I will be able soon..Still having trouble to fix things in my head... :(
I'm using a beautiful semi solid brown BFL wool as first colour...the yarn is gorgeous to knit with. So soft and have a beautiful shine. BFL wools makes beautiful shades of browns, almost like if it had some silk in it :)
